FLOWERING LOCUS T3 Controls Spikelet Initiation But Not Floral Development.
Plant physiology - 1 Nov 2018
Mulki Muhammad Aman, Bi Xiaojing, von Korff Maria
Abstract excerpt
In many angiosperm plants, FLOWERING LOCUS T (FT)-like genes have duplicated and functionally diverged to control different reproductive traits or stages. Barley (Hordeum vulgare) carries several FT-like genes, the functions of which are not well understood. We characterized the role of HvFT3 in the vegetative and reproductive development of barley.
